/* CSS-Definitionsdatei, die SiteStyle-Stylesheets enthält */
* { margin: 0; padding: 0; }

p { margin: 15px 0; }

ul { list-style: none; }

BODY {
  color: #000000;
  font-family: Arial, Helvetica, Geneva, Sans-serif;
  font-size: 14px;
  background-image: url(/la-maison-d-oliver-de/themes/la-maison-d-oliver-de/images/hintergrund2.jpg);
  background-attachment: fixed;
}

#frame_div {
  margin-top:0px;
  margin-bottom:0px;
  float:left;
  width:1200px; /*920px;*/
  text-align: left;
  background-color: #ffffff;
  border: 1.8px solid #ffffff;
  border-radius: 8px;
  box-shadow: 5px 5px 5px #666;
}

#top_div {
  margin-left: 0px;
  margin-bottom:0px;
  padding-top: 0px;
  padding-bottom: 0px;
  height:80px;
  background-color: #fae1a5;
}

#nav {
  margin-top:-13px;
  margin-right:0px;

  float:right;
  font-size:10px;
  font-weight:bold;
  z-index:10000;
}


/* 
	LEVEL ONE
*/
ul.dropdown                         { position: relative; }
ul.dropdown li                      { 
  margin-left:12px; /*0px;*/
  margin-right:12px; /*10px;*/
  padding-left:0%; /*0px;*/
  font-weight: bold; 
  float: left;
  zoom: 1;
  font-size: 11px;
  font-weight: bold;
  color:#ffffff;
  background-color: #fc9a08; /*dunkelorange*/ /*#0e6900; dunkelgruen*/ 
  
  -webkit-border-radius: 20px;
  -moz-border-radius: 20px;
  border-radius: 20px;
  behavior: url(/PIE.php);
}

ul.dropdown a:hover		            { color:#ffffff; }
ul.dropdown a:active                { color: #ffffff; }
ul.dropdown li a                    { 
  display: block; 
  padding-left: 14px;
  padding-right: 14px;
  padding-top: 5px;
  padding-bottom: 5px;
  text-decoration: none;
  color: #ffffff;
}

ul.dropdown li:last-child a         { border-right: none; } /* Doesn't work in IE */
ul.dropdown li.hover,
ul.dropdown li:hover                { 
  background: #91ceff; /*dunkelgruen*/ /*#fc9a08; dunkelorange*/
  color: #ffffff;
  position: relative;
  z-index:1000;

  -webkit-border-radius: 20px;
  -moz-border-radius: 20px;
  border-radius: 20px;
  behavior: url(/PIE.php);

}
ul.dropdown li.hover a              { color: #ffffff; }


/* 
	LEVEL TWO
*/
ul.dropdown ul 						{ width: 220px; visibility: hidden; position: absolute; top: 100%; left: 0; }
ul.dropdown ul li 					{ font-weight: normal; background: #f6f6f6; color: #000; 
                         border-bottom: 1px solid #ccc; float: none; }

/* IE 6 & 7 Needs Inline Block */
ul.dropdown ul li a					{ border-right: none; width: 100%; display: inline-block; } 

/* 
	LEVEL THREE
*/
ul.dropdown ul ul 					{ left: 100%; top: 0; }
ul.dropdown li:hover > ul 			{ visibility: visible; }


.textContent {
  padding-top:0px;
  padding-bottom:20px;
  width:100%;
  margin-left:0px; 
  float:left;
}

#content_div {
  float:left;
  margin-top: 0px;
  width:1200px;
}

.imageContent {
  width:1200px;
  height:600px;
  margin-top: 0px;
  float:left;    
  text-align: left;
}

#content_div_kontakt {
  float:left;
  width:1200px;
}

a {
  text-decoration: none;
  color: #f2681a;
}

a:hover {
  text-decoration: underline;
}


h1 {
  margin-top:0px;
  font-size:15px;
  font-weight:bold;
  color:#000000;
}

h2 {
  margin-top:0px;
  font-size:12px;
  font-weight:bold;
  color:#8a0102;
}



.textContent_anfahrt {
  padding-top:15px;
  padding-bottom:15px;
  width:700px;
  /*height:200px;*/
  float:left;
  padding-left:70px;
}

.textBox {
  float:left;
  margin-left:35px;
  margin-top: 10px;
  width:1081px;
  padding:2%;/*10px;*/
  color:#000000;
  background-color: #fae1a5;
  border: 1px solid #fc9a08;
  box-shadow: 5px 5px 5px #666;
  /*border:solid #666666 1px;*/
  /*background-color: #ebd4b9;*/
  /*
  background-color: #ffffff;
  -webkit-box-shadow: #666 5px 5px 5px;
  -moz-box-shadow: #666 5px 5px 5px;
  box-shadow: #666 5px 5px 5px;
  */
  /*border-radius: 8px;*/
  /*font-size:11px;
  behavior: url(/PIE.php);
  */
}

.textBox_anfahrt {
  width:1000px;
  height:430px;
  background-color: #ffffff;
  border:solid #2e2317 1px;
  padding:10px;
  -webkit-box-shadow: #666 5px 5px 5px;
  -moz-box-shadow: #666 5px 5px 5px;
  box-shadow: #666 5px 5px 5px;
  /*border-radius: 8px;*/
  behavior: url(/PIE.php);
}

#bottom_div {
    padding-top: 10px;
    padding-left: 20px;
    padding-right: 20px;
    padding-bottom: 20px;
    margin-bottom: 20px;
    float: left;
    width: 250px;
    margin-top: 10px;
    margin-left: 737px;
    color: #000000;
    border: solid #fc9a08 1px;
    background-color: #FAE1A5;
    -webkit-box-shadow: #666 5px 5px 5px;
    -moz-box-shadow: #666 5px 5px 5px;
    box-shadow: #666 5px 5px 5px;
    
    position: absolute;
}

#bottom_div a {
  color:#f2681a;
}

.kontakt_textfeld {
  width:300px;
  height:18px;
}

.kontakt_element {
  border:solid #8a0102 1px;
}

#anfahrt {
  float:left;
  width:980px;
  height:400px;
}

.ad-image {
  border-top:solid 0px #ffffff;
  border-left:solid 0px #ffffff;
  border-right:solid 0px #ffffff;
  border-bottom:solid 0px #ffffff;
}
